  • In the decanter 3 hours prior to drinking, drank over a couple hours. Deeply coloured, garnet, dense and opaque. A densely packed meaty and hearty shiraz, with ripe red and black plums, redcurrant, mixed berries, charcuterie and still quite a bit of cedar oak, albeit not over powering and fades over time. Grainy tannins slowly round, however at a ripe, [modest] 14.5% this feels a tad out of balance with overripe heat but no heat, and doesn’t quite roll over the palate. A big wine, perhaps better with food, but wont be for all. In a good space now, drink over the next few years.

  • Ripe blackberries with sweet vanilla, a hint of licorice and a bit of cooling eucalyptus. Fresh acidity and powdery tannins.

    At the ripe end for cool climate Shiraz, but still showing a lighter alternative to Barossa. Really good.
